Image Property owners find cell tower lease negotiation a very terrifying experience. In case, a landlord is approached by a cell tower company or cellular carrier to build a cell tower on their land or install antennas on their rooftop, they should not sign the deal in a hurry. There are many scary and shocking evidences regarding negotiation of cell tower lease. A cell tower lease agreement is very different from the typical rental contracts. This is the reason even expert attorneys who deal with the general house and office rental lease, are unable to figure out the hidden clause in the cell tower lease negotiation

The cell tower companies are very large, fast and powerful. They have the caliber to misguide even the best real estate developers. Their lease agreement contains language that is unknown to most of the typical attorneys. While negotiating a cell tower lease, landowners should seek advice from the experts who help them maximize their site values and try to get the best possible terms on their lease agreement, lease extensions, lease buyouts and lease amendments. With their industry knowledge and experience, they are able to level the playing field in negotiating lease agreements directly with the carriers.

Cell tower lease experts are well aware of the issues that are a matter of concern to the carriers. Because every time new standard lease rates go up, landlords have no idea where to begin evaluating their real market value. Cell tower lease rates vary according to several factors such as different zoning classification, ground evaluation and size of the land. During negotiation, experienced consultants try to determine the highest value the company will pay before they choose to abandon the lease plan. They help the property owners to convince the carriers to maximize the lease rate. They are given advice how to hold the company and how to win their confidence at time of negotiation so that they do not lose the deal altogether.

So, are you planning to negotiate cell tower lease rate with a wireless carrier? Then try to figure out what is the current tower lease rate in your state. The most densely populated area will command a very high lease rate whereas land site in a more rural setting will command low rental rate. Sometimes lease re-negotiation contractors are hired by the cell tower companies so as to re-engineer the terms of the lease a few years later. With the help of cell tower lease experts, study the agreement thoroughly before coming to a final decision.
